AvailableOreana Savor is a young female Shih Poo, with a small frame and long, luxurious white and cream coat. She is spayed and her vaccinations are up to date. This sweetheart is house trained and has a friendly disposition, getting along well with both dogs and children. Currently located in Plano, TX, Oreana is waiting for a loving home to call her own.
About Oreana Savor
Meet Oreana Savor! This sweet, 3-year-old Shih Poo is an absolute delight. With her long legs, she's earned the nickname "baby deer" and has a personality to match. She loves to give hugs and is known to lay her head on your shoulder, instantly making you fall in love. Oreana is working hard on her potty training and gets excited anytime she has a successful outing, prancing back to her foster mom for praise. She gets along well with her foster siblings, sleeping peacefully through the night, and proves to be a great coworker, content to lounge beside her while she works. During breaks, Oreana enjoys sunbathing, receiving belly rubs, and gently nibbling on fingers. She’s attentive, always monitoring her foster mom, especially when food is involved.
